The Benefits of a Student Credit Card
A student credit card has a number of very real advantages for students, from providing much needed financial support when you need it to offering a range of incentives, and even the chance to create a good credit record for when you leave education.
One of the things that you must bear in mind is that student credit cards tend to have a much higher rate of interest attached. If you are able and willing to clear the balance each month then you will be fine, but if you are likely to be unable to do this, then it is very important to limit your spending to essential items as the interest could become very costly.
Most student cards have a range of incentives attached, and it will be important to make sure that you pay as much attention to these as to aspects such as fees and interest rates. Both will be important sine the incentives could very easily help save money, depending on your circumstances. From cheap travel to free insurance and even discounts on books, these cards could save you money as you spend it.
Most students have little or no credit history, which means that when you graduate you could find it difficult to obtain a bank account or open a standard credit card. A student credit card provides a good opportunity to demonstrate that you can run a credit account in good order, so that you build a good credit file for later years.
